What's your favorite tool?
Mine is my ratcheting head tubing cutters. Perfect for small spaces like repairing pipes next to studs without making too large a hole in the drywall, or brake lines. Better than the typical "minis", aka "finger cutters", because you still have the leverage of a full length handle.
